Note: It has been subsequently claimed by manager Eoin Hand that the Republic of Ireland actually lost 1–2 to a local club side on 30 May, then defeated Trinidad and Tobago 3–0 on 3 June, but the Trinidad and Tobago Football Association swapped around the results so that the first game was the "official" international and the second game reclassified as a friendly. In the absence of any media reports or FAI officials, there was no-one to gainsay them [1] [2] |
